 I can provide you with tips on how to write and publish an ebook in British English. Here are some steps you can follow: 

1. Choose a topic: Decide on a topic for your ebook. It should be something you're knowledgeable about and passionate about. Make sure there's a market for it and that it's not too niche. 

2. Research: Conduct thorough research on your chosen topic. This will help you develop your content and ensure that it's accurate and informative.

3.  Write: Start writing your ebook. Create an outline to help you organize your thoughts and ensure that you cover all the important points. Write in clear and concise British English. 

4. Edit: Once you've finished writing, edit your ebook. Check for spelling and grammar errors, and make sure your writing flows well. 

5. Design: Create a visually appealing design for your ebook. Use a professional cover design and format your content to make it easy to read. 

6. Publish: Choose a platform to publish your ebook. You can self-publish on Amazon or other online marketplaces, or you can use a publishing service. Make sure to follow their guidelines and requirements.

7.  Market: Once your ebook is published, you need to market it to potential readers. Use social media, email marketing, and other digital marketing tactics to promote your ebook. 

8. Update: Keep your ebook updated with new information and revisions as necessary. This will help you maintain your credibility and keep your readers engaged. 

Writing and publishing an ebook in British English can be a rewarding experience. By following these steps, you can create a high-quality ebook that informs, entertains, and engages your audience.

Develop an app



 I can provide you with some tips on how to develop an app. Here are some steps you can follow:

1. Define your concept: Identify what kind of app you want to create, what problem it solves or what value it adds, and who your target audience is.


2. Conduct market research: Analyze the market trends, competitors, and user needs to validate your app concept and refine it further.


3. Design the app: Create wireframes and prototypes to visualize how your app will look and function. Use a design language that is user-friendly and aligned with British English conventions.


4. Develop the app: Hire developers, or learn to code yourself, and build the app based on the design and specifications. Test the app thoroughly to ensure it works smoothly and is bug-free.


5. Launch the app: Publish the app on the relevant app store(s) and ensure it is optimized for searchability, ease of use, and app ratings.


6. Market the app: Use social media, online advertising, and other marketing channels to promote your app to your target audience. Encourage users to leave reviews and ratings.


7. Maintain and improve the app: Keep improving the app based on user feedback and analytics, and release updates regularly. This will ensure that the app stays relevant and engaging to users.

When developing an app, it is important to consider the cultural nuances and preferences of the target audience. You may need to localize the app for specific regions or use language that is commonly used in the UK. By following these steps, you can create a successful app that caters to speakers and adds value to their lives.
